HIST 2003 - Survey of New York State History

Level: 
Lower
Credits: 
3
Prerequisites: 

HIST 1143 with D or better or HIST 2153 with D or better

Course Attributes: 
Liberal Arts and Science
Description: 

Students will be introduced to the history of New York State, from the pre-colonial Iroquoian hegemony to modern New York. The focus will be on the social, political, cultural, and economic developments and events that made New York the Empire State. Special emphasis will be placed on the individuals who contributed to state growth in these areas. Students will complete a research paper/project.
